Middlesbrough new boy Lukas Jutkiewicz set for bow in FA Cup derby against Sunderland

LUKAS Jutkiewicz is in line to make his full Middlesbrough debut in this Sunday’s FA Cup derby clash at Sunderland, writes CRAIG HOPE.

The 22-year-old was unable to make his bow against former club Coventry City at the weekend because of a ‘gentleman’s agreement’ between the two managers, Tony Mowbray and Andy Thorn.

But Jutkiewicz – who signed a four-and-a-half-year deal at Boro last week – is not cup tied from his time at the Ricoh Arena and is therefore free to face the Black Cats in the fourth-round tie.

“It’s a great game to play in,” he told SportMail. “And hopefully I’m involved.

“I’m not cup tied thankfully but I’ll have to see what the manager wants to do.”
